Meaning of the Name
Ana is a feminine name of Hebrew origin meaning 'grace' or 'favor.' It conveys a sense of elegance, mercy, and divine blessing.

Famous People Named Ana
Ana de Armas
Actress
Academy Award-nominated for her portrayal of Marilyn Monroe in 'Blonde'
Ana Ivanovic
Tennis Player
Former World No. 1 and 2008 French Open champion
Anaïs Nin
Writer
Groundbreaking diarist and author of erotic literature
Ana Mendieta
Artist
Pioneering performance and land artist known for feminist works

Cultural & Historical Significance
In Hispanic and Latin American cultures, Ana became one of the most enduring and beloved names, often combined with Maria (as in Maria Ana) to honor both the Virgin Mary and Saint Anne. The name's simplicity and elegance made it a staple across European nobility and common families alike. In literature, characters named Ana often embody grace, intelligence, and moral complexity, from Tolstoy's Anna Karenina to modern heroines, reflecting the name's timeless appeal and cultural adaptability across centuries. The name has maintained its cross-cultural resonance, serving as a bridge between different linguistic and religious communities while preserving its core meaning of grace and favor.

Modern Usage & Popularity
In contemporary times, Ana remains a popular and versatile name across many cultures, though its usage patterns have evolved. In English-speaking countries, it maintains steady popularity as an elegant alternative to the more common 'Anna,' often ranking within the top 200 names for girls. The name enjoys particular strength in Hispanic communities, where it frequently appears in compound names like Ana Maria or Ana Sofia. Recent decades have seen Ana embraced by parents seeking a name that is both classic and internationally recognizable, yet distinctive enough to stand out. Its simplicity and cross-cultural appeal make it a favorite among multicultural families, while its biblical roots continue to attract religious parents. The name's popularity has been bolstered by prominent figures in entertainment, sports, and arts, ensuring its continued relevance in the modern naming landscape without feeling dated or overly trendy.
